Overview
Selorm Adzaku is a Pediatric Endocrinologist in Houston, Texas. Dr. Adzaku is rated as an Experienced provider by MediFind in the treatment of Non-Alcoholic Fatty Liver Disease. Her top areas of expertise are Type 1 Diabetes (T1D), Diabetic Ketoacidosis, Short Stature (Growth Disorders), and Familial Short Stature (FSS).
Her clinical research consists of co-authoring 6 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
